===Vehicles=== *'''Attack Helicopter:''' A flying flamethrower (or flame machinegun if you want more punch) is a terrifying prospect for your foes, especially with a 2+ defense and Fast. Buying scout is a major plus, since it gets you into range for your gun and (if you buy it) Attack Bomb so you can make a strafing run for a practically guaranteed 3 AP 2 hits on one unit this thing flies over. *'''Bomber Helicopter:''' This helicopter comes with a machinegun, giving a much better range than the other helicopter's weapons. It also comes with a bombing run, a much more potent version of the Attack Bombs since this can proc three times on a unit. *'''Giant Construct:''' You've got a giant robot. NICE. So, this giant has two fists that can already smash infantry and most monsters pretty quickly, but you could instead replace either fist with a great weapon for an insane AP 4. You can also buy heavy steam guns so it can handle small crowds. *'''Flame Cannon:''' Your first piece of artillery is the rather short-ranged flame cannon. However, this gives you a good number of shots at AP 2, so you can screen blocks of infantry quickly. *'''Bolt Thrower:''' A big crossbow that has the best range of the artillery pieces here and AP 2 Deadly 3 so it can kill elite units without much hassle. *'''Organ Gun:''' Gives you an absolute storm of dakka, but at a shorter range than you'd expect. *'''Cannon:''' Excellent range, AP 4 Blast 3. It's all you can ask for in an artillery piece, though it's a good bit costly for its job. *'''Stone Thrower:''' Also has great range. The stone thrower is the only weapon in your entire army with Blast 6, so expect to bring one when dealing with big blocks. However, it price means that you might not be able to bring other artillery pieces as well.
